Protecting Young Drivers: Good Tips for Parents

Most young people daydream about the day they will get their drivers license; nonetheless, many parents dread this same time. Almost everyone knows a teenager who has been involved in a bad motorcar accident. What can a parent do to protect his or her child?. Begin by talking with them about automobile safety. In addition, parents can enroll their potential teenage driver in a drivers instruction class. The upshot of this is lower automobile premiums and a better prepared driver.

Why should you take driver education classes?

Growing up is a natural part of life and getting a drivers license is another step in the process. Unfortunately, approximately 300 young drivers and their passengers are killed each year in the UK and many more are seriously injured. On the other hand, young drivers who took additional drivers education courses reduced their risk for a serious automobile accident. Also, these courses not only save lives, but money through reduced insurance premiums. You may not be able stop your baby birds from growing up and leaving the nest; however you can let them go safer and cheaper by enrolling them in a drivers education course.

Which conditions are most likely to cause to accidents?

Many teenagers drive older pre-owned vehicles; unfortunately, these cars are not always equipped with the latest safety equipment. Data shows that teenagers with numerous passengers and traveling on Friday or Saturday night will increase the likelihood of an accident. Lastly, weather conditions which result in wet weather can be difficult for an inexperienced driver to maneuver.

There is in fact a form of car insurance for young drivers that discourages drivers from driving at more dangerous times of the day. Known as pay per drive insurance the driver charged for the miles they drive. For example the highest mileage rates will be charged for the most dangerous times such as the middle of the nght.

Who is the most liable to crash?

Young drivers, particularly those under 25, are at most risk of an motorcar accident according to the accident data. Also, researchers report the risk crests right after a driver receives his or her first license. Keep in mind; studies indicate that male drivers are twice as likely as female drivers to be involved in an automobile collision.

Where can you be taught accident avoidance techniques?

Although nothing can take the place of experience, many teenagers benefit from taking additional driving lessons. Pass Plus is a new driver education course offered by the Driving Standards Agency (DSA). The Driving Academy at Mercedes-Benz World offers a driving experience class for soon-to-be new drivers. Safety driven driver training courses are available from the Institute of Advanced Motorists (IAM).

What Is a Will?

Don t leave your wife and kids with additional costs and hassle.
People who die without a valid will, or intestate, result in complications and costs to their beneficiaries and often gift thousands of £’s to the Country in what may be avoidable Inheritance Tax (IHT).

The Law Society says that anyone with possessions and family or friends should make a will, disregarding of their age. It is particularly important if you are not married to your partner, because the law does not accord partners the same rights automatically of inheritance as spouses.
Assets which are jointly owned by unmarried partners on a joint tenancy basis would still go to automatically to the existing spouse under the rules of survivorship. Under the current intestacy rules, an unmarried partner has no rights to assets and property that were not jointly owned (although the Law Commission has recently suggested to change this).

Making a will is also essential if you have children, as you can propose guardians to look after them.

It is essential to produce a list of assets and liabilities and their approximate worth. Include your properties, investment, savings, insurance policies and pension.
In addition, think about individual legacies. Simply telling a beneficiary that an item will be his or hers one day could cause problems later.

You should take professional advice on IHT planning as part of writing your will. Easy steps could save the beneficiaries of more prosperous homeowners thousands of £’s in tax.

A key element of preparing a will is the naming of executors to ensure that your will instructions are carried out correctly.

You should also update your will every few years or so and whenever your circumstances are altered by a substantial life event, such as wedding, split up or a birth or death in the immediate family. Another instance would be after a house buy or move.

Whoever makes up your will, make sure at least 1 copy is kept secure or deposit 1 with a probate registry.

Getting Noticed at a Career Faire

Standing out at a Job Faire can make a difference in your search. Job Faires are starting to pick up, and Dice is running some nice ones, called Targeted Job Fairs. At a Silicon Valley Job Fair in January, 10 companies as showing up, and Dice has 82 job fairs scheduled for 2010 across the US.

How do you stand out at a Career Fair? The contention can be noteworthy, but you can help yourself stick out from the crowd with early preparation. At AA-Careers, we have a straight-forward 6-step process to prepare. Plan to go? Here’s how to prepare:

First, research the companies that are going and pick your objectives. Use the internet to check out the companies that are there before you even decide to go. Go to their sites and see if they have their jobs listed. Pick a tenable number to target, and get ready to spend up to an hour researching each one. It’s hard to do more than eight in a day, and four or five is a much more reasonable target. For each hiring company, you want to know: executive names, recent news, and key product lines. Try to see if you know anyone at the target companies. You will end up with with a page or two of research for each company/job.

Second, if there are job openings on the web, read them to see what the hiring manager is looking for. Create a mapping of your achievements and skills to the demands of the job. Make the language match. If the hiring organization calls customers "clients", your resume should do the same thing. The accomplishments should be written in the style of the hiring company.

Third, create a ‘mini sales pitch’ for each likely company/job combination. Write down a 90 second ‘thumbnail’ that you can repeat verbally showing why you are a great prospect for that job. You’ll use this in your resume and when you meet people at the job stall.

Fourth, modify your resume for each job type. The objective on your resume should exactly match the job you’re want. The executive summary should be a written form of your “mini sales pitch” for the job. Then choose the accomplishments and skills that most clearly match the job prerequisites. Especially at a Job Faire, the purpose of your resume is a sales tool for you – to get you on-site job interviews. It should be very easy to see that you’re a fit based on your resume.

Fifth, practice your ‘mini-sales-pitch’. Collect your research and the resume for each opportunity - bring a couple of copies for each – and put each in a understandably marked folder. Keep them in a light briefcase or folio.

Finally, dress and prepare as if you’re doing on-site interviews. Dress well and be well groomed. Avoid strong cologne or perfume…use any cologne or fragrance meagerly, if at all.

Remember to smile, and good hunting!

Picking out a Driving Teacher: Some Important Advice

Before you get behind the wheel, it is imperative that you hire a driving instructor to help you become an excellent driver. It is important you get the best advice and are as well prepared as possible before you hit the open road.Endeavour to find a good, professional instructor. Finding the right driving instructor is crucial for your learning. The perfect driving instructor should be registered with the (DSA) which stands for Driving Standards Agency. It is ilegal for any non-DSA registered driving instructor to charge for lessons. These DSA registered instructors are usually referred to as ADI’s (Approved Driving Instructors).

A good instructor will teach you all aspects of driving. This includes motorway driving, parallel parking, emergency stopping, hill starts and much more. Another reason to choose an approved instructor An Approved Driving Instructor will have a green certificate on the car windscreen. A pink certificate indicates a trainee ADI. The DSA has rigourous standards and tests to pass before approving any prospective instructor. Before being allowed to instruct you any trainee must pass a comprehensive driving test and have a clean license for 4 years beforing being approved.

Obesity Heart Disease

There are many people in the United States that suffer from obesity, and heart disease. These diseases are often caused by poor eating habits and a lack of exercise. Many suffer from these illnesses which can often times be prevented. Obesity is a condition in which there is an accumulation of excess fat that can negatively affect ones health. Heart disease is a disorder that affects the heart. These can include Angina, Arrhythmia, Congenital heart disease ect..

Millions of americans have chronic diseases related to poor exercise and diet. Many of these individuals will be placed on medications in an effort to control their illnesses. Obesity is not only affecting adults it is increasingly affecting young children. Obesity are risk factors for many chronic diseases including diabetes, high blood pressure, high cholesterol, and heart disease. There are healthy ways to combat obesity, and in combating obesity you will also be fighting other related diseases. Exercise can be your first line of defense for combating obesity, and heart disease.

The best type of exercise to perform are cardio or aerobic type exercises. These types of exercises include, running, walking, or step aerobics. Performing these types of exercises for at least 30 minutes can help to burn fat and calories. Other methods of combating obesity and heart disease is to eat more fruits and vegetables. Eliminating fast food from your diet can also reduce the amount of fat that you can consume in your diet. Fast foods, processed foods and snack products are extremely high in sodium and fat which can further increase unhealthy weight gain. Controling obesity by losing the weight can significantly reduce your risk for contracting chronic illnesses such as diabetes, stroke and heart disease.
